International qualifications in English language


There are many different qualifications in English for speakers of other languages.
Well-known British qualifications in English as a second or foreign language include the Cambridge FCE (First Certificate in English), the Cambridge CPE (Certificate of Proficiency in English), the Cambridge CAE (Certificate in Advanced English) and IELTS (International English language Testing System).
IELTS is accepted as evidence of ability in English language for entry to British Universities, although the score required may vary for different university courses.
T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language) is a widely known US qualification.
